35 #
36 # DESCRIPTION:
37 #
38 # zpool set returns an error when run as a user
39 #
40 # STRATEGY:
41 # 1. Attempt to set some properties on a pool
42 # 2. Verify the command fails
43 #
44 #
45
46 verify_runnable "global"
47
48 log_assert "zpool set returns an error when run as a user"
49
50 set -A props $POOL_NAMES
51 set -A prop_vals $POOL_VALS
52 set -A prop_new $POOL_ALTVALS
53
54 while [[ $i -lt ${#args[*]} ]]
55 do
56 PROP=${props[$i]}
57 EXPECTED=${prop_vals[$i]}
58 NEW=${prop_new[$i]}
59 log_mustnot $POOL set $PROP=$NEW $TESTPOOL
60
61 # Now verify that the above command did nothing
62 ACTUAL=$( zpool get $PROP $TESTPOOL | grep $PROP | awk '{print $1}' )
63 if [ "$ACTUAL" != "$EXPECTED" ]
64 then
65 log_fail "Property $PROP was set to $ACTUAL, expected $EXPECTED"
66 fi
67 i=$(( $i + 1 ))
68 done
69
70
71 log_pass "zpool set returns an error when run as a user"
